Decoding what is personalized cancer medicine: Tailored Treatments for Enhanced Outcomes
What is personalized cancer medicine concerns tailoring treatment plans specifically to the individual characteristics of each patient.
Through analyzing a patient's genetic information, doctors can forecast which treatments Continue reading are most likely to be effective, reducing the risk of side effects and improving the likelihood of successful outcomes.
This approach is transforming the landscape of oncology, yielding treatments that are as unique as the patients themselves.
Customized medicine not only improves treatment efficacy but also enhances patient quality of life by avoiding unnecessary or ineffective treatments.
